Chill Foundation at Perisher
Last week the CHILL Foundation joined forces with leading snowboard company Burton, Youth Off The Streets and the Perisher Resort to provide an opportunity for 14 at-risk youth to visit the snow and learn to snowboard through the CHILL snow program. Continue reading “Chill Foundation at Perisher”

Brights’ Pipe Officially Named
Torah Bright has be honored at Perisher this weekend with their Superpipe officially re-named “Brights’ Pipe”. The dedication goes out not only to Torah, but her bro Ben Bright who has been coaching Torah and a long-time Perisher shredder. Continue reading “Brights’ Pipe Officially Named”

Perisher First to Open their Superpipe
Perisher have just opened their 17 foot superpipe for riding a couple days ago, much to the delight of the local shred heads. They are the first in Australia to open their pipe for the winter 2010 season and it is already being put to some solid use. Continue reading “Perisher First to Open their Superpipe”
